Songs for ages 3-8 are a vital resource for parents and teachers, as they play a pivotal role in early childhood development. First and foremost, music fosters language acquisition; catchy melodies and repetitive phrases help children grasp vocabulary, phonetics, and language rhythms, enhancing their linguistic abilities. Furthermore, songs help improve memory retention, as the repetitive nature of lyrics aids children in recalling information, which is fundamental for learning.
In addition to cognitive benefits, songs foster emotional and social development. They often explore themes of friendship, sharing, and feelings, allowing children to engage in discussions about emotions and social situations in a fun and relatable way. Singing also promotes physical development; clapping, dancing, and moving to music improve motor skills and coordination.
Moreover, group singing activities create a sense of community and belonging, reinforcing social skills like cooperation and empathy. By incorporating songs into learning, parents and teachers can create a joyful educational environment that captures children's interest and enhances their concentration. In essence, songs for ages 3-8 serve as powerful tools that nurture the whole child—intellectually, socially, and emotionally—making them essential for positive early learning experiences.
